Mattel unveils Whitney Houston Barbie, capturing her iconic 1987 look. This tribute highlights Houston's lasting cultural impact.

In simple terms, Mattel has announced the release of a new Barbie Signature doll inspired by Whitney Houston, reflecting her iconic look from the beloved 1987 music video, "I Wanna Dance With Somebody (Who Loves Me)." The doll is priced at $60 and officially debuted on August 8, 2026, available at Target and other online retailers.
This announcement was made by Variety and confirms the release during a significant year, as it marks over four decades since Houston emerged as one of pop music's most influential voices. The collaboration between Houston's estate and Mattel aims to honor her legacy and celebrate her impact on both music and culture.
The Whitney Houston Barbie captures the vibrant essence of the singer's persona, featuring her well-known purple tank dress, colorful drop earrings, and bold makeup. Notably, the doll is outfitted with a microphone stand, ready for a performance, encapsulating Houston’s dynamic stage presence.
Pat Houston, the executor of the Estate of Whitney E. Houston and president of the Whitney E. Houston Legacy Foundation, played a pivotal role in this project, working closely with Mattel to ensure that every detail — from the wardrobe to the overall glam — truly reflects the late icon's essence. This hands-on approach helps maintain authenticity and provides fans with a meaningful collectible.
Whitney Houston's legacy is profound, highlighted by her record-breaking hits and multiple awards, including a Grammy for Best Female Pop Vocal Performance in 1988 for “I Wanna Dance With Somebody.” The song itself stands as one of her defining anthems and showcases her extraordinary vocal talent. Her career includes multiple milestones, such as being the first female artist to have an album debut at No. 1 on the Billboard 200, signifying her groundbreaking influence in the music industry.
The release of the Whitney Houston Barbie joins other musical icons represented in the Barbie Signature line, which has featured stars like Tina Turner and Mariah Carey, further expanding on Mattel's commitment to honoring influential women in music and culture.
To celebrate the doll’s launch, Whitney Houston Barbie made her official debut at the fifth annual Legacy of Love Gala in Atlanta, hosted by the Whitney E. Houston Legacy Foundation. This event not only marked the product's launch but also provided an opportunity for fans and admirers to come together and celebrate Houston's remarkable contributions to music and legacy.
